Florence "Ruth" Drennan

March 1, 2019

January 1, 1923 - March 1, 2019
On March 1, 2019 Ruth died in the Vernon Jubilee Hospital. She was born on January 1, 1923 and lived most of her early and adult years in the Ottawa Valley in Ontario and Quebec. She and her husband Johnny lived on the family farm near Lachute, Quebec. They made several moves in retirement before Johnny died in March, 1976 in Salmon Arm, BC.

Ruth then lived in Cushing, Quebec on the Ottawa River for several years before moving to Vankleek Hill, Ontario the town of her birth. She then relocated to Hondo, Alberta for a number of years before moving to Armstrong in 1994. Ruth enjoyed her association with Zion United Church, the Seniors Center and especially the card parties on Saturday evenings. She has lived in Creekside Landing assisted living in Vernon from 2012 until her recent death.

Ruth is survived by her son John and his wife Barbara, their three children and seven great-grandchildren all living in Alberta. Her other son Rod and his wife Ruth live in Vernon. She was predeceased by her eldest son Willy in a childhood drowning accident on their farm.

Ruth's two sons wish to thank the staff and other residents at Creekside Landing in Vernon for their kind and careful attention to their mother. They also wish to thank Dr. Alastair Annan of Enderby and Dr. Michael Murphy in Vernon for the respectful medical care provided to their mother.

A Celebration of Life event for Ruth will be held on son John's farm in Alberta in early summer of this year.
